How to Run an Email Marketing Campaign in Qatar?

Email marketing is one of the most effective methods for reaching a targeted audience, and this is especially true in Qatar. With a population of over 2.8 million people and a rapidly growing digital market, Qatar offers immense opportunities for businesses looking to expand their influence. However, to successfully execute an email marketing campaign in Qatar, it’s crucial to follow key steps and consider the cultural and technological specifics of the region.

1. Understanding the Qatari Market

Before launching your campaign, it’s essential to have a deep understanding of the Qatari market. Qatar is a country with a strong expatriate presence, representing nearly 85% of the population. Native Qataris are a minority, which means your campaign needs to address a diverse audience. Additionally, Qatar is a high-income country, meaning consumers are often well-informed and expect high-quality communications. Therefore, it’s important to segment your email list to ensure that your messages are relevant to each demographic group.

2. Compliance with Local Regulations

As in any other country, it is essential to comply with local email marketing regulations. In Qatar, although there are no specific laws as strict as in Europe (such as GDPR), it is always preferable to obtain explicit consent from recipients before sending emails. Use clear opt-in methods and ensure that recipients can easily unsubscribe.

3. Segmenting Your Database

Segmenting your database is crucial to the success of your campaign. You should divide your email list into segments based on criteria such as age, gender, nationality, purchasing preferences, or even location. For example, Indian or Filipino expatriates may respond differently to an offer compared to native Qataris. This segmentation allows you to personalize your messages and increase open and conversion rates.

4. Creating Tailored Content

The content of your emails must be relevant and engaging to your Qatari audience. Use catchy subject lines and ensure the content is relevant to the recipients. The content should be visually appealing and optimized for mobile devices, as a large portion of the population accesses their emails via smartphones. Additionally, consider using Arabic in your communications, especially if you are targeting native Qataris.

5. Timing and Frequency of Emails

The timing of your emails is also crucial. In Qatar, weekends fall on Fridays and Saturdays, so it might be better to send emails at the beginning of the week. As for frequency, be careful not to bombard your subscribers with too many emails, as this could lead them to unsubscribe. A weekly or bi-weekly email is generally a good practice.

6. Monitoring and Analyzing Results

Once your campaign is launched, it’s important to monitor and analyze the results. Use analytics tools to track open rates, click-through rates, and conversions. This will help you understand what works and what doesn’t, and adjust your future campaigns accordingly.

7. Continuous Optimization

Email marketing is an ongoing process. Use the data collected to refine your segments, improve your content, and continuously adjust your strategy. Test different subject lines, content, and send times to see what works best for your specific audience in Qatar.

In conclusion, a successful email marketing campaign in Qatar requires a deep understanding of the market, precise segmentation, and well-tailored content. By following these steps and continuously optimizing your approach, you can maximize the impact of your campaigns and achieve your marketing goals in Qatar.
